How to apply for exhibition opportunities

Exhibition Proposals 101 is a practical, accessible workshop designed to support artists and makers to develop strong, clear exhibition proposals.

Presented by Craft in partnership with the Brimbank City Council, this session will unpack what makes a compelling project proposal, how selection processes work, and how to communicate your creative practice with confidence and clarity.

Whether you are applying for your first exhibition opportunity or looking to strengthen your existing proposals, this workshop will provide practical tools, examples and insights you can apply immediately.

In this workshop, you’ll learn:

– What galleries are looking for in an exhibition proposal
– How to clearly articulate your concept, intent and outcomes
– How to structure key proposal components including artist statements, project descriptions and support material
– How to tailor proposals to different opportunities
– Common pitfalls to avoid
– Tips for strengthening your supporting documentation and images

Presented by Craft as part of INfuse, which connects our creative community through workshops, artist talks and presentations, providing training and inspiration for artists.
